NASHIK – The tranquil industrial hub of Nashik has become the epicenter of a corporate firestorm as the TCS (Tata Consultancy Services) BPO facility faces a widening probe into what investigators are calling an “organized gang” operation involving systematic religious and sexual harassment.

Following a series of internal whistleblowings and subsequent police complaints, the facility has effectively halted physical operations. Thousands of employees have been directed to work from home as a special task force and internal HR committees delve into allegations that have sent shockwaves through India’s IT sector.

The Allegations: A Toxic “Cult-Like” Culture

The crisis erupted when a group of employees came forward with detailed accounts of a coordinated group within the management and mid-level hierarchy that allegedly enforced a discriminatory environment. The complaints allege:

  • Systematic Harassment: Targeted religious and sexual harassment of junior staff, particularly women.
  • Coercion Tactics: Reports of an “organized gang” within the office that used performance reviews and project allocations as leverage to silence victims.
  • A Culture of Fear: Employees described a “cult-like” atmosphere where dissent was met with immediate professional retaliation or personal shaming.

A TCS spokesperson confirmed that the company has a “zero-tolerance policy” toward any form of harassment and is cooperating fully with the Nashik police. “We are committed to providing a safe and inclusive workplace. Any individual found violating our code of conduct will face immediate and exemplary action,” the statement read.

Wider Implications: The “TCS Nashik Case” Impact

The incident has triggered a broader conversation about workplace safety in decentralized BPO hubs. Industry bodies are now calling for more stringent third-party audits of regional offices, which often operate with less direct oversight than major metropolitan headquarters.
